    Role Summary:

    The Global Credit & Collection Team is looking for a Sr. Credit Risk & Collection Analyst. This role is responsible for achieving assigned F&A roles to reach organizational vision, & these roles are vital to keep our books of accounts & financials accurate globally.

    We rely on a meticulous financial system to drive business forward. Our Credit & Collection Analysis department keeps that system running smoothly by managing Credit checks as well as preparing various types of reports applicable for statutory requirements.

    We're searching for a skilled financial associate to join our Credit & Collections Team to help perform thorough credit checks, track, and record customer records in an accurate, efficient, and timely manner. He/ She is tasked with the responsibility of assessing a person's or a company's riskiness in terms of both extending credit and collecting repayments. We are looking for a professional Credit Risk Analyst to determine our customers' creditworthiness. You will analyze financial data to assess the likelihood of a borrower honoring their financial obligations.

    Roles & Responsibilities:

  • Independently assess creditworthiness of existing or prospective clients
  • Examine financial transactions and credit history case by case (applications, statements, balance sheets, legal documents etc.)
  • Complete ratio, trend and cash flows analysis and create projections.
  • Deliver a multi-dimensional perspective on the investment outlook in an accessible and informative manner.
  • Run various reports and parse them in accordance with statutory requirements.
  • Determine in depth the degree of risk involved.
  • Carefully analyze data and produce clear and objective reports.
  • Routinely monitor loans for compliance.
  • Adhere to credit policy and guidelines.
  • Monitor corporate portfolio asset quality on an ongoing basis.
  • Utilize Excel and Power BI (Working knowledge).
  • Assisting customers with inquiries.
  • Acting as a liaison between internal and external customers to troubleshoot and resolve issues that may cause deductions and or delays in payments.
  • Reconciling customer account as needed.
  • Processing adjustments for write-offs for approval upon research.
  • Processing requests for credit limits based on recommendation per credit check.
  • Research and account reconciliations for portfolio of accounts.
  • Assisting in acquisition activities related to AR as needed.
  • Acting as a liaison between customer and deductions and internal department on dispute resolution.
  • Assisting in SOX audit support as needed.
  • Draft models of credit information that predict trends and patterns.
  • Working with Global stakeholders with transition experience.
